Marked puck on upper margin. Reads General Hancock private back action book, the governors island gun settles the southern claimants and the northern agitators. Depicts the Governor in a center island with a cannon that shoots both directions. Framed in a reddish wood grain style wooden frame with off white Mat board. Approx 27.5 X 20 inches window measures 19 x 12 inches. Moderate wearing to frame and creasing to illustration.
